PrestaShop Seller Listing Options module
Posted: Sat Apr 28, 2012 2:42 pm
What is this module does?
This module will allow the store owner to provide paid listing options for sellers to list with additional fee. For example, List/Show at HOME, show as HOT, show on list TOP of the category. Seller has to pay the option fees first before the product and its options become in effect.
Compatible PrestaShop Version
This module compatible with PrestaShop 1.4x
This module is accessory module. It will not work without Agile PrestaShop Multiple Seller module.
Functionalities of PrestaShop affected by installing this mule.
Once this module is installed, the Home Featured module will be hijacked, only those product selected “show at HOME” and paid (if fee is not 0) will be listed on Home Featured product list.
At back office catalog, the HOME category will not be available to Sellers, because it will be available via product listing option – show as HOME.
At backoffice catalog product page, following listing options will be added to the product attribute at the right upper corner of the screen.
Features and how the options work
Basic list option must always be selected if there is any other option is selected.
All list options must be paid before it become in effect.
The option fees payment will go through front store checkout process, and a order will be placed when option fees payment is done.
Seller is able to pay listing options fees to store owner by any payment method that is available at your PrestaShop.
If price is set zero (0), then this option is free. It will become in effect as long as you select it and save it.
Once the option is in effect, the option is disabled and seller it not able to change it until it expires.
Once basic listing is expired, all other listing options will not be in effect even if those options are not expired because they added later than basic listing.
The listing duration (expiration) is configurable at modules screen by days, weeks, months or year.
Seller is able to disable the product by status (active/inactive) even when the listing options are still in effect.
The product choose to show on top will be choose randomly for fairness of sellers. Those products do not choose “shop on TOP” will be listed after those “show on TOP”.
If the option price is not set, it will be implicitly applied as 0 (free)
Update log
Ver 1.0 - 2012.02.15
- all basic features at first version described above
Ver 1.1.0 - 2012.08.21
- Change the listing valid period to at list option level. Each list option could have different length of list period.
- Fix a bug the get_home_products SQL to show seller name
- Fixed the basic list option date update issue;
- Fixed the get home product issue(Basic list option must be paid);
Some screenshot image
This module will allow the store owner to provide paid listing options for sellers to list with additional fee. For example, List/Show at HOME, show as HOT, show on list TOP of the category. Seller has to pay the option fees first before the product and its options become in effect.
Compatible PrestaShop Version
This module compatible with PrestaShop 1.4x
This module is accessory module. It will not work without Agile PrestaShop Multiple Seller module.
Functionalities of PrestaShop affected by installing this mule.
Once this module is installed, the Home Featured module will be hijacked, only those product selected “show at HOME” and paid (if fee is not 0) will be listed on Home Featured product list.
At back office catalog, the HOME category will not be available to Sellers, because it will be available via product listing option – show as HOME.
At backoffice catalog product page, following listing options will be added to the product attribute at the right upper corner of the screen.
Features and how the options work
Basic list option must always be selected if there is any other option is selected.
All list options must be paid before it become in effect.
The option fees payment will go through front store checkout process, and a order will be placed when option fees payment is done.
Seller is able to pay listing options fees to store owner by any payment method that is available at your PrestaShop.
If price is set zero (0), then this option is free. It will become in effect as long as you select it and save it.
Once the option is in effect, the option is disabled and seller it not able to change it until it expires.
Once basic listing is expired, all other listing options will not be in effect even if those options are not expired because they added later than basic listing.
The listing duration (expiration) is configurable at modules screen by days, weeks, months or year.
Seller is able to disable the product by status (active/inactive) even when the listing options are still in effect.
The product choose to show on top will be choose randomly for fairness of sellers. Those products do not choose “shop on TOP” will be listed after those “show on TOP”.
If the option price is not set, it will be implicitly applied as 0 (free)
Update log
Ver 1.0 - 2012.02.15
- all basic features at first version described above
Ver 1.1.0 - 2012.08.21
- Change the listing valid period to at list option level. Each list option could have different length of list period.
- Fix a bug the get_home_products SQL to show seller name
- Fixed the basic list option date update issue;
- Fixed the get home product issue(Basic list option must be paid);
Some screenshot image